Web14 feb. 2024 · Therefore, Taking I. tectorum as the research object, 16S rRNA high-throughput sequencing technology was used to analyze the effects of Cr pollution on the structure, composition, diversity, and symbiotic network of soil microbial community under different cultivation modes and to explore the effects of Cr pollution on soil microbial … Web1 mei 2015 · Mariculture has undergone a rapid development in China during the last three decades. The annual production reached 14, 823,008 t in 2010, making China the largest mariculture producer in the world. As the production increases, the nutrient concentrations of mariculture waters in China have been continuously rising for several decades [20].
